Quotes from the boss ahead of tonight's game...

  • Dino reflects on Saturday's win...

“It did not really change much from Monday the performance, I thought there were certain aspects of the game where we need to improve.

“As a back four we can always get better, as a front six we need to get better as well.

“I thought we pressed them pretty well and we got stronger as the game got on. We defended their set plays really well and I thought we should have scored two or three.

“I like to dominate possession though and I thought we did not do that, especially in the second half. Hopefully going forward that is one aspect of the game we can improve on."

  • Dino delighted with how the boys are progressing…

“The biggest thing is the progress we are making, performance after performance we are getting better and that is the biggest positive.

“Yes, the results have improved too, but it is delightful for our performance levels to be improving, with results backing it as well.

“It is very good because I always look at improvement in performance, I do not look at the end product.

“The end product is there, but there is a process to it and that is where I am coming from.

“I keep talking about the process of winning, but you have got to do a lot of things right to keep winning consistently and that is what we do."

  • Dino on a big week at home...

“Two tough games but it is great that they are back at home.

“Since I have come here I have tried to improve our away form, which is improving.

“And of course, we can always improve our home form as well, we know that we are good at home.

“Although Mansfield have lost four on the bounce, I have watched their last couple of games against Luton and Crewe and they were very unlucky to not take something out of the game.

“They still have a very good chance to make it into the play-offs, so I am sure it will be a very tough game.

“We take each game at a time but hopefully we will beat Mansfield and that will give us a real positive mentality to attack the game against Cambridge in the local derby on Saturday."
